The Ultimate Piano

Browser-Based Piano Playground

Forget everything you know about clunky music software. This whole party happens right in your browser tab. Fire up Chrome, Safari, whatever, and you're instantly at a gorgeous, realistic-sounding piano. Use your mouse, your laptop keyboard, or plug in a pro MIDI controller—it's all good. The sound is legit, making every note feel alive, and you can start smashing keys in seconds with zero installs. It's the definition of "plug and play," but for your musical soul.

MIDI File Jedi & Falling Notes Visualizer

Got a MIDI file of that epic movie theme or a tricky classical piece? Load it up and watch the magic happen. The notes light up on the keyboard as they play, like a super chill version of those rhythm games. The real power move? You can slow the tempo way down to nail a hard part, loop a specific section on repeat until you own it, or even step through note-by-note. It's like having a patient, digital teacher who never gets tired of your mistakes.

Real-Time Chord Detective & Theory Explorer

This feature is straight-up witchcraft. As you're freely jamming, The Ultimate Piano listens and instantly displays the name of the chord you're playing. No more guessing! It's a game-changer for understanding how music fits together. Plus, dive into the Chord and Scale Explorer to see any of 14+ scale types visualized right on the keys. Want to see the Blues Scale in A-flat? Boom, it's highlighted. It turns boring music theory into an interactive light show.

YouTube & Audio Sidekick

Wanna learn that viral TikTok piano cover or practice with your favorite track? This tool is your ultimate wingman. Paste any YouTube URL directly into the player, or upload your own MP3. Then, you can slow down the playback without making it sound like a demonic possession, set A-B loops to drill a specific 10-second part a million times, and even save markers to jump back to the chorus instantly. It seamlessly syncs your practice with the actual music.

The Ultimate Piano FAQ

Do I need to install anything to use Ultimate Piano?

Nope, zero, zilch, nada! That's the whole vibe. It runs directly in your web browser (Chrome, Firefox, Safari, etc.) so you can start playing instantly. No downloads, no updates to worry about. Just head to the website and get your practice on.

Can I connect my real MIDI keyboard?

Absolutely, and you totally should if you have one! Just plug your MIDI keyboard into your computer via USB, give the site permission to access it (your browser will ask), and you're golden. It'll work just like a digital piano, with way more features. You can even connect a sustain pedal for that authentic, floaty sound.

What chords and scales can I learn?

You name it, it's probably in there. The tool recognizes chords in real-time as you play them. For learning, the Scale Trainer and Explorer cover all the essentials—major, minor (natural, harmonic, melodic), pentatonic, blues, modes like Dorian and Mixolydian, and more. It's a full music theory encyclopedia, but interactive and actually fun.

Can I practice along with my own songs?

For sure! You've got two killer options. Use the Audio Player to upload an MP3 or any audio file from your computer. Or, use the YouTube Player to paste a link to any song, tutorial, or performance on YouTube. Both players let you slow down the audio, loop sections, and jam along on the virtual keys. It's the perfect way to learn by playing with the pros.
